Episode notes
The episode opens with the Battlefield 6 beta: its strong participation on Steam, player reception, and the debate over comparing it with Call of Duty. It also questions the requirements of its PC anti-cheat system, including the use of Secure Boot. The hosts then discuss the Xbox ROG Ally launch rumor and expectations for Hollow Knight: Silksong and Metroid Prime 4.
The show covers the cancellation of Contraband, the status of OD, and Digital Foundry's independence. It also addresses Fox Hunt, the multiplayer mode planned for the Metal Gear Solid 3 remake, and Donkey Kong Bananza's local GameShare support on the original Nintendo Switch. The discussion pauses on a possible multi-platform expansion by PlayStation, the costs of major productions, and rumors about future consoles.
In the impressions segment, one participant gives a positive assessment of a game set in Sicily, highlighting its presentation, linear structure, and atmosphere. The closing section returns to Battlefield 6 to detail its destruction, modes, classes, vehicles, and player cooperation, with a favorable assessment of the beta while its PC performance still needs further checking.
